## Idempotency Keys for Payment Retries (Lumopay)

Every retry of a charge request must reuse the original idempotency key; generating a new key on retry can produce duplicate charges. Keys are scoped per merchant and expire after 48 hours. Reviewers should verify keys are derived server-side, never from client input. The full key-generation specification and threat model are maintained on the internal page.

dashboard of kaguf-tawip = https://vault.merlaqsys.test/issue

Heads-up for whoever's on call this week: I'm merging the rebalance pass for the Quillgate pick-list optimizer. Short version — it now batches aisles by travel cost instead of SKU count, so pickers at the Dorvane warehouse stop zigzagging. If throughput tanks, don't roll back the whole thing; the batching is gated behind config, so you can soften it live. Watch the `pick_batch_latency` dashboard for the first few shifts. The knobs you'd actually touch in an incident are these.

tuning constants:
QUOTAS = {
    "druwyn": 5,
    "holix": 5,
    "zorath": 5,
    "holwyn": 10,
}

Hey Priya, handing off SnackRoute, our vending-machine restock planner, before your security review. Quick context: the planner pulls inventory pings from the Kestrelton depot hubs every 20 minutes and builds routes overnight. Marco rewrote the auth layer last sprint, so token refresh is saner now, but the cron worker still runs under the old service account — flagging that for you. Nothing exotic in the stack otherwise. For the audit, here are the current production configuration values for the service.

deployment values, yahag-tawef:
ZORWYN_HOST=zorwyn.tolvaqlabs.internal
ZORWYN_PORT=9300

### 4.2.1 — Renamed retention sweeper setting

`SWEEP_INTERVAL` is now `DUSTPAN_SWEEP_INTERVAL_MIN` to match the Dustpan naming scheme. Old name still read with a deprecation warning; removal in 5.0. Units changed from seconds to minutes — halve nothing, just convert. Update cron wrappers and staging env files before upgrading. Migration script rewrites the key automatically but not the broker credential, which must be set directly below this entry in the env file.

secret setting of tahog-kahap: COURIER_KEY8=1c6aac8a